private void propertyGridControl_CustomExpand(object sender, CustomExpandEventArgs args)
 {
     // Если выставлена привязка ReadOnly="{Binding Path=SelectedItem.Predefered}",
       // то не зависимо, выставлен флаг ExpandCategoriesWhenSelectedObjectChanged или нет,
       // категории не раскрываются. Как обходное решение, взято ручное раскрытие категорий.
       // Источник: https://www.devexpress.com/Support/Center/Question/Details/T253463.
       args.IsExpanded = true;
 }
示例#2
0
        void OnCustomExpand(object sender, CustomExpandEventArgs args)
        {
            args.IsExpanded = true;
            args.Handled    = true;

            optionsGroupCounter--;
            if (optionsGroupCounter == 0)
            {
                UnsubscribeEvents();
            }
        }
 void PropertyGridControl_OnCustomExpand(object sender, CustomExpandEventArgs args)
 {
     if (args.Row.FullPath == "Product" && !object.Equals(ExpandedProduct, args.Row.EditableObject) && !args.IsExpanded)
     {
         ExpandedProduct = args.Row.EditableObject;
         args.IsExpanded = true;
         args.Handled    = true;
     }
     if (args.Row.FullPath == "Tags" && !object.Equals(Tags, args.Row.EditableObject) && !args.IsExpanded)
     {
         Tags            = args.Row.EditableObject;
         args.IsExpanded = true;
         args.Handled    = true;
     }
 }
示例#4
0
 void PropertyGridControl_OnCustomExpand(object sender, CustomExpandEventArgs args)
 {
     args.IsExpanded = true;
     args.Handled    = true;
 }
示例#5
0
 private void pGrid_CustomExpand(object sender, CustomExpandEventArgs args)
 {
     args.IsExpanded = true; // to expand all rows
 }